Direct-Conversion Tuner ICs for
Digital DBS Applications
_______________________________________________________________________________________
9
Pin Description
RF Ground. Connect directly to the ground plane.
GND
9, 11,
19, 24
Automatic Gain-Control Input. Bypass this pin with a 1000pF capacitor close to the pin, to minimize cou-
pling.
AGC
10
Q Channel Baseband Output
QOUT
13
Baseband +5V Supply. Bypass with a 10pF capacitor from this pin to pin 12 (GND), as close to the IC as
possible. Connect an additional 0.1µF capacitor in parallel with the 10pF capacitor (placement less critical).
VCC
14
Q Channel Offset-Correction Noninverting Input. Connect a 0.22µF (typ) capacitor between QDC and QDC.
This capacitor must be placed as close to the IC as possible (see
Layout Considerations section).
QDC
15
Ground (substrate)
GND
5
RF +5V Supply. Bypass with a 22pF capacitor from this pin to pin 9 (GND), as close to the IC as possible.
VCC
6
RF Noninverting Input. Couple through a 22pF capacitor directly to a 50
Ω signal source.
RFIN
7
RF Inverting Input. Connect to a 22pF series capacitor and a 51
Ω resistor to ground.
RFIN
8
RF +5V Supply. Bypass with a 22pF capacitor from this pin to pin 11 (GND), as close to the IC as possible.
VCC
4
Baseband Ground
GND
3, 12
PIN
I Channel Baseband Output
IOUT
2
Baseband +5V Supply. Bypass with a 10pF capacitor from this pin to pin 3 (GND), as close to the IC as
possible. Connect an additional 0.1µF capacitor in parallel with the 10pF capacitor (placement less critical).
VCC
1
FUNCTION
NAME
Q Channel Offset-Correction Inverting Input. Connect a 0.22µF (typ) capacitor between QDC and QDC. This
capacitor must be placed as close to the IC as possible (see
Layout Considerations section).
QDC
16
I Channel Offset-Correction Inverting Input. Connect a 0.22µF (typ) capacitor between IDC and IDC. This
capacitor must be placed as close to the IC as possible (see
Layout Considerations section).
IDC
17
I Channel Offset-Correction Noninverting Input. Connect a 0.22µF (typ) capacitor between IDC and IDC.
This capacitor must be placed as close to the IC as possible (see
Layout Considerations section).
IDC
18
RF +5V Supply. Bypass with a 10pF capacitor from this pin to pin 19 (GND) as close to the IC as possible.
VCC
20
Local-Oscillator Complementary Input Port (Figure 1)
LO
21
Local-Oscillator Input Port (Figure 1)
LO
22
RF +5V Supply. Bypass with a 10pF capacitor from this pin to pin 24 (GND) as close to the IC as possible.
VCC
23
Prescaler Ground. To disable the prescaler, leave this pin open.
PSGND
25
Prescaler Output. Drives CMOS load. Connect 2k
Ω from this pin to GND (if the prescaler is enabled).
PSOUT
26
Prescaler Modulus Control. Leave open when the prescaler is disabled.
MOD
27
Prescaler +5V Supply. Must be connected even if the prescaler is disabled. Bypass with a 1000pF
capacitor.
VCC
28
